Navigating the comprehensive regulatory landscape of medical spas in Florida can be a complex task. A key component of this process is securing the services of a qualified medical director, a doctor with specialized training and experience in dermatology or a associated field.
Florida law mandates that every med spa utilize a licensed medical director who oversees the entirety of the spa's operations. The medical director is responsible for confirming that all treatments are performed safely and efficiently.
To achieve compliance, med spas must thoroughly evaluate potential medical directors, considering their credentials. A thorough background check, including verification of permits, is crucial.
Furthermore, the chosen medical director should have a clear understanding of Florida's guidelines governing med spa practices.
This includes familiarity with requirements for staff training, recordkeeping, and handling patient data.
Ultimately, selecting the right medical director is crucial to the thriving of a Florida med spa. A qualified professional not only upholds legal compliance but also adds value to the overall safety and quality of patient care.

Medical Liability and Insurance for Florida Medspa Practitioners
Operating a medspa in Florida requires practitioners to navigate intricate legal landscape. Material financial liability exists due to the nature of the procedures performed in medspa settings. To protect their assets, Florida medspa practitioners must secure adequate medical malpractice protection. This type of insurance provides a financial buffer against claims arising from complaints of negligence or omissions during treatment.
- Moreover, Florida enforces specific licensing and certification for medspa practitioners to guarantee a minimum level of expertise.
- Neglecting to comply with these guidelines can result in harsh consequences, including license suspension or revocation.
To reduce their risk, Florida medspa practitioners should collaborate with an experienced counsel specializing in medical liability. This guidance can help businesses understand the nuances of Florida law and implement procedures to protect themselves against potential claims.
